Tania, who is in her tenth week of pregnancy, is concerned about the fetus growing inside her. Having her first child at the age of 40, she is worried that the baby may suffer from Down syndrome. Which of the following prenatal test would best suit Tania if she plans to obtain such information?
A in vitro fertilization
B amniocentesis
C pap smear test
D chorionic villus sampling
Answer: D chorionic villus sampling
